Summary:This book begins with an introduction to bifacial solar cells and goes on to look at design, characterisation, reliability; energy yield prediction simulation models; PV systems and yield data (bifacial gain); levelized cost of PV-generated electricity; PV technologies market introduction and their bankability; geographic location and environmental conditions relating to bifacial gain; and prospects for the future.
